Description

Removal of county courthouse. Provides that certain provisions regarding removal of a county courthouse shall not apply to the removal or relocation of any county courthouse, whether located on county or city property, that is entirely surrounded by a city, and any such courthouse shall be removed or relocated only in accordance with the existing procedures.
